Breathing Techniques in Pilates

Have you ever wondered if your breathing technique is hindering your Pilates practice? Let’s explore how proper breathing can enhance your mind-body connection.

In Pilates, diaphragmatic breathing is the foundation of all movement. It involves inhaling deeply through the nose and exhaling fully through the mouth, using the diaphragm muscle to expand and contract the lungs. This allows for a greater intake of oxygen, which fuels the muscles and enhances overall performance.

To truly master diaphragmatic breathing, it’s important to focus on ribcage expansion as well. As you inhale deeply, imagine your ribcage expanding in all directions like an accordion opening up. Then as you exhale fully, feel your ribcage gently closing back in towards your body. By incorporating this visualization into your breathwork, you can deepen your mind-body connection and unlock new levels of physical awareness.

Improving Posture and Self-confidence

By practicing Pilates, you’ll stand taller and radiate confidence. It’s amazing how our posture can impact the way we feel about ourselves, both physically and emotionally.

Pilates exercises focus on correcting posture by strengthening the core muscles which helps to align the spine and improve overall body alignment. This not only makes you look more confident but also boosts your self-esteem.

Here are 3 ways that Pilates can help improve posture and boost confidence:

  1. Strengthening of core muscles: When your core muscles are strong, they support your spine and help maintain good posture throughout the day.

  2. Increased awareness of body alignment: Through Pilates practice, you become more aware of how you hold yourself in daily life, enabling you to correct bad habits like slouching or hunching over.

  3. Improved balance: As you work on improving your posture through Pilates, you’ll notice an improvement in balance as well. This is because better alignment allows for a more stable base from which to move.

With improved posture comes greater confidence in yourself and your abilities. The benefits of Pilates extend beyond just physical changes; it promotes inner peace and balance as well.

Finding the Right Pilates Instructor

You’ll be amazed by the impact an experienced Pilates instructor can have on your fitness journey. It’s important to find the right fit for you, someone who has the necessary qualifications and experience to guide you through your practice.

A good Pilates instructor should not only have a strong understanding of the exercises, but also be able to effectively communicate and demonstrate them. When looking for a Pilates instructor, consider their credentials and training. Look for certifications from reputable organizations such as the Pilates Method Alliance or Balanced Body.

Additionally, take note of their teaching style and personality – it’s important that you feel comfortable with them and trust their guidance. Finding the right instructor can make all the difference in reaching your fitness goals.

Are there any age restrictions for practicing Pilates?

Whether you’re a senior or expecting, Pilates can be an excellent exercise option for you. There are no age restrictions for practicing Pilates, and modifications can always be made to accommodate different skill levels and physical limitations.

Senior Pilates classes may focus more on mobility and flexibility, while pregnancy Pilates classes will emphasize safe exercises for the expecting mother. Regardless of your age or fitness level, Pilates offers a low-impact workout that can improve posture, increase strength, and reduce stress.
